Description

Exo-2-Chloronorbornane is a specialized bicyclic organic compound featuring a chlorine substituent in the exo configuration. This unique structural motif makes it a valuable and versatile chiral building block and intermediate in advanced organic synthesis. It is particularly sought after by research and development teams in the pharmaceutical and agrochemical sectors for constructing complex molecular architectures. Its defined stereochemistry is critical for applications requiring high enantiomeric purity.

Basic Information

Product Name Exo-2-Chloronorbornane
CAS No. 765-91-3
Molecular Formula C7H11Cl
Molecular Weight 130.62 g/mol
Synonyms 2-exo-Chloronorbornane; Bicyclo[2.2.1]heptane, 2-chloro-, exo-; exo-2-Chlorobicyclo[2.2.1]heptane; NSC 60545; 2-Chloronorbornane (exo-); exo-Norcamphor chloride; 1,4-Methano-1H-indene, hexahydro-2-chloro-, exo-
EINECS 212-163-1
